En el mundo empresarial, Excel es una herramienta clave para gestionar gran cantidad de información. Sin embargo, una de las principales dificultades a la hora de manejar datos en una hoja de cálculo es evitar la aparición de datos duplicados. La presencia de estos datos puede comprometer la precisión de los resultados y producir errores que afecten a la toma de decisiones.
Para evitar estos problemas, existe una solución: el uso de macros en Excel. Las macros son una serie de instrucciones que permiten automatizar tareas repetitivas y ahorrar tiempo en la gestión de datos. En este artículo, te mostraremos cómo usar macros para evitar la aparición de datos duplicados en Excel.
Te explicaremos los riesgos que conlleva tener datos duplicados en una hoja de cálculo, y te enseñaremos cómo detectarlos y eliminarlos utilizando la herramienta “Quitar duplicados” o fórmulas específicas. Además, aprenderás a crear una macro personalizada que impida la introducción de datos duplicados en la hoja de Excel. Todo ello, con ejemplos y pasos detallados para que puedas aplicar estas técnicas en tu trabajo diario y evitar futuros problemas de precisión en tus informes y análisis. ¡Comencemos!
Definición de datos duplicados en Excel
En Excel, los
datos duplicados
son aquellos que aparecen más de una vez en un mismo rango o lista de datos. La presencia de datos duplicados puede causar problemas de precisión en el análisis de datos, lo que conduce a resultados erróneos.
Uso de macros en Excel para evitar datos duplicados
Para garantizar la integridad de los datos y evitar la entrada de datos duplicados en Excel, se deben utilizar herramientas como las
macros en Excel
. Una macro es un conjunto de comandos que automatizan tareas repetitivas, como la eliminación de datos duplicados o la validación de datos.
Uso de la función CONTAR.SI para evitar datos duplicados
Una de las formas más efectivas de utilizar una macro para evitar la entrada de
datos duplicados
es mediante la función CONTAR.SI. Esta función permite verificar si un valor determinado ya aparece en un rango de celdas.
Acceso a recursos especializados para mejorar el manejo de datos en Excel
Además, existen
cursos especializados y libros
, como “Holy Macro! It’s 2,500 Excel VBA Examples” publicado por Holy Macro! Books, que se dedica a publicar libros especializados para usuarios de Microsoft Office. Con estos recursos, es posible mejorar la productividad y la eficiencia en el manejo de datos en Excel mediante el uso de macros y otras herramientas avanzadas.
En conclusión, es fundamental utilizar herramientas de validación de datos como la macro y la función CONTAR.SI para asegurar la precisión y evitar la entrada de datos duplicados en Excel. La habilidad de utilizar estas herramientas requiere conocimientos de programación en VBA y puede ser mejorada a través del acceso a recursos especializados.
Los riesgos de tener datos duplicados en una hoja de cálculo
Errores en una hoja de cálculo.
Los datos duplicados pueden ser una fuente importante de errores en una hoja de cálculo de Excel, especialmente cuando se trata de grandes cantidades de información.
Pérdida de información importante.
Esto puede llevar a problemas graves, como la toma de decisiones basadas en datos incorrectos, o incluso la pérdida de información importante.
Importancia de prevenir duplicados.
Para evitar estos riesgos, el uso de macros en Excel es una técnica muy útil.
Cómo utilizar macros para prevenir datos duplicados
Automatizar tareas repetitivas.
Una macro puede ser un pequeño programa que automatiza tareas repetitivas en Excel.
Comparar los datos automáticamente.
Con una macro, se puede comparar automáticamente los datos introducidos por el usuario con el contenido de la hoja de cálculo para detectar entradas duplicadas.
Código de ejemplo.
El ejemplo de código mencionado en el texto muestra cómo verificar la existencia de un valor en un rango de celdas en todas las hojas de cálculo del libro actual. Si el valor ya existe, la macro impide que se agregue una entrada duplicada.
Beneficios de utilizar macros
Ahorro de tiempo.
El uso de macros no solo ahorra tiempo, sino que también reduce los errores de entrada de datos, aumenta la consistencia y mejora la calidad de los informes y análisis.
Apoyo técnico y recursos gratuitos.
En el texto también se menciona la posibilidad de obtener soporte técnico y enviar comentarios sobre la programación de macros en VBA para Office. Además, se presenta la opción de descargar un archivo Excel y suscribirte a un curso gratuito para mejorar la productividad en Excel con macros que automatizan tareas.
Importancia de los datos precisos y coherentes
La calidad de los datos depende de las personas que los ingresan.
Si bien usar macros puede ser muy útil, también es importante tener en cuenta que la calidad de los datos depende en gran medida de las personas que los ingresan.
Introducción de datos precisos.
Por lo tanto, es importante que los usuarios sean conscientes de la importancia de introducir datos precisos y coherentes para evitar la aparición de datos duplicados y otros errores.
En conclusión, evitar datos duplicados es una tarea importante en Excel que puede ser fácilmente resuelta mediante el uso de macros. La programación de macros puede ser utilizada para automatizar la comparación de datos en una hoja de cálculo y para prevenir la creación de entradas duplicadas. Además, aprender a programar macros puede aumentar la eficiencia y la calidad del trabajo realizado con Excel.
Cómo evitar datos duplicados en Excel
Eliminar datos duplicados en Excel es una tarea importante en la gestión de hojas de cálculo. La herramienta “Quitar duplicados” en Excel funciona bien para eliminar datos duplicados de una hoja de cálculo, pero ¿cómo se evita que los datos duplicados se introduzcan en primer lugar?
Validación de datos en Excel
Una técnica común utilizada por muchos usuarios de Excel es la validación de datos. La función CONTAR.SI se utiliza para verificar que un dato ingresado solo aparezca una vez en un rango de celdas seleccionado. Si se ingresa un dato existente, aparece un mensaje de error.
Creación de una macro para evitar ingreso de datos duplicados
Otra técnica para evitar datos duplicados es mediante la creación de una macro que impida la introducción de datos duplicados. Holy Macro! Books, un sitio dedicado a publicar libros para usuarios de Microsoft Office, proporciona un ejemplo de código para verificar la existencia de un valor en un rango de celdas en todas las hojas de cálculo del libro actual.
En el ejemplo de código presentado, la macro se activa cada vez que el usuario cambia la selección y busca el valor ingresado en la columna 3 (C). Si encuentra un valor duplicado en el rango de la columna anterior a la selección y la fila 25, el código muestra un mensaje indicando la fila en la que se encuentra el valor duplicado. Aunque el autor señala que el código no funciona del todo bien y está buscando una solución para notificar al usuario cuando se introduce un dato duplicado.
Importancia de evitar datos duplicados
En resumen, existen varias técnicas para evitar que los datos duplicados se introduzcan en una hoja de cálculo de Excel, incluyendo la validación de datos y la creación de macros. Estas técnicas pueden ayudar a garantizar que los datos sean precisos y fiables para su posterior análisis y uso. Además, Holy Macro! Books ofrece una amplia variedad de recursos y soporte técnico relacionado con el uso de VBA para Office, que pueden ser de gran ayuda para los usuarios de Excel.
Personalización de la macro según tus necesidades específicas
Si trabajas con Excel, es probable que hayas enfrentado la frustración de tener datos duplicados en tus hojas de cálculo. Esto puede ser especialmente molesto si estás trabajando con una gran cantidad de información, ya que la presencia de duplicados puede afectar la precisión de tus datos y hacer que tu trabajo sea más complicado.
Para solucionar este problema, puedes utilizar
macros en Excel
que te permiten verificar automáticamente si hay duplicados en tus hojas de cálculo y evitar su introducción. La macro específica que utilices puede variar según tus necesidades, pero siempre podrás
personalizarla según tus requerimientos específicos
.
Función CONTAR.SI en macros de Excel
Una opción común es utilizar la función CONTAR.SI de Excel, que permite verificar la existencia de un valor en un rango de celdas y evitar la introducción de datos duplicados en ese mismo rango. Con la ayuda de esta función, podrás crear una
macro que se active cada vez que ingreses datos en Excel
y que te indique si estás a punto de introducir un dato que ya existe.
Recuerda que
la función CONTAR.SI se utiliza para validar datos
, lo que significa que solamente te permitirá ingresar valores que cumplan con el criterio que especifiques, en este caso que el dato sea único en un rango de celdas dado.
Recursos para personalizar tus macros
Si necesitas
ayuda para personalizar tu macro o para crear una desde cero
, puedes consultar una gran cantidad de recursos en línea, como tutoriales, foros y blogs especializados. Además, algunos libros, como “Holy Macro! It’s 2,500 Excel VBA Examples”, ofrecen
ejemplos prácticos de macros
para evitar datos duplicados en Excel.
Otro recurso valioso es la opción de
soporte técnico y feedback que ofrece Microsoft Office
. Si tienes alguna consulta o sugerencia respecto al trabajo con macros en Excel, podrás
enviar comentarios y recibir asistencia
para solucionar tus problemas y mejorar tu productividad.
En definitiva, utilizar macros en Excel es una excelente manera de evitar la aparición de datos duplicados en tus hojas de cálculo y mantener la integridad de tus datos. Con una
macro personalizada y un enfoque práctico
, podrás
automatizar tus tareas y mejorar tu eficiencia en tu trabajo diario
.
Prácticas recomendadas para evitar datos duplicados en Excel
Validación de datos
La
validación de datos
es una función muy útil para prevenir la entrada de datos duplicados. Puede activarse en Excel utilizando la función CONTAR.SI, que permite verificar si el valor ingresado por el usuario ya existe en un rango determinado. Si se detecta un valor duplicado, aparece un mensaje de error, lo que ayuda a evitar la introducción de datos redundantes.
Uso de macro
La creación de una
macro
en Excel es una opción efectiva para detectar y prevenir la entrada de datos duplicados. La macro puede implementarse utilizando el lenguaje de programación VBA y, mediante la utilización de la función CONTAR.SI, realizar la verificación de la presencia de datos repetidos en el rango seleccionado.
Conclusión
En definitiva, existen distintas formas de evitar la aparición de datos duplicados en Excel, siendo la
validación de datos
y el
uso de una macro
dos de las opciones más efectivas. Además, la implementación de estas prácticas permitirá mejorar la calidad de los datos, disminuir el tiempo que se requiere para su procesamiento y, en definitiva, mejorar la eficiencia en el trabajo diario.
Por último, cabe destacar que la utilización de macros en Excel requiere de ciertos conocimientos en programación, sin embargo, existen múltiples recursos en línea y cursos gratuitos que pueden ayudar a los usuarios a mejorar sus habilidades y su productividad en Excel.
En Excel Office Expert siempre estamos buscando formas de mejorar tu experiencia en el manejo de esta herramienta, y hoy te hemos presentado una guía detallada sobre cómo evitar datos duplicados en Excel con macro. Hemos definido qué son los datos duplicados, analizado los riesgos que estos pueden presentar en una hoja de cálculo, explorado diferentes formas de detectarlos, y te hemos mostrado cómo crear una macro para evitar su introducción. Además, te hemos brindado prácticas recomendadas para evitar datos duplicados en Excel. Si te ha resultado útil esta información, te invitamos a visitar nuestro blog para conocer más trucos, tips y técnicas para aprovechar al máximo todo el potencial de Excel.¡Hasta la próxima!
Relacionados

Soy Alejandro Menoyo, ingeniero informático de profesión y tu asesor en Word Office Expert. Desde hace años, he dominado el paquete de Microsoft Office, utilizando su poder y versatilidad para resolver problemas complejos y simplificar la vida de las personas.
Como ingeniero informático, me he adentrado profundamente en los entresijos de la tecnología de la información, adquiriendo un entendimiento profundo de cómo las herramientas digitales pueden usarse para optimizar el trabajo y la creatividad. Mi objetivo es ayudarte a desbloquear el potencial completo de estas herramientas para que puedas aplicarlas en tu trabajo, tus estudios o tus proyectos personales.
Como experto en el paquete Office de Microsoft, me apasiona la idea de compartir mi conocimiento contigo. Si estás buscando aprender desde cero, mejorar tus habilidades actuales o incluso convertirte en un experto, estoy aquí para guiarte en cada paso del camino.
La informática no es sólo mi profesión, sino mi pasión. A través de los años, he visto cómo la correcta aplicación de estas herramientas puede transformar las vidas de las personas, y es un privilegio poder contribuir a ese proceso.
Así que, no importa si tienes un problema específico para resolver, o simplemente quieres saber más sobre lo que Microsoft Office puede hacer por ti, estoy aquí para ayudarte. Juntos, podemos hacer que la tecnología sea tu aliada, y no un desafío a superar. ¡Espero que disfrutes el viaje tanto como yo!